The ONLY good choice for a helmet is the one that fits best and is DOT and/or ECE rated and possibly Snell 2010 rated. Again, the single most important factor is whether or not it fits your head. If it's too tight then it may not provide the impact protection you need, should you unfortunately ever need it. Conversely, if it is too loose, then your head can literally be damaged by bouncing around in the helmet.

Arai is a great helmet manufacturer, but if it doesn't fit your head right, then it isn't the best helmet for you. If possible, always try on helmets before you buy.
